Fatality · MSHA Record #219982150001
Laborer
July 16, 1998
at 10:30 AM
Operator:
Summit Anthracite Inc
(John Scheib et al)
Schuylkill County, PA
Classification
IGNITION OR EXPLOSION OF GAS OR DUST
Type
Struck by concussion
Investigator narrative
TWO MINERS WERE ASSIGNED WORK IN THE MONKEY HEADING OF THE 2ND LEVEL EAST GANGWAY WORKING. THEY APPARENTLY WERE PREPARING A HITCH FOR ROOF SUPPORT IN THE CYCLE OF MINING, AND AS THEY FRED THE HITCH, A POCKET OF METHANE GAS WAS IGNITED CAUSIING AN EXPLOSION TO OCCUR. THE RESUTLING EXPLOSION CAUSED FATAL INJURIES TO ONE AND SERIOUS INJURIES TO OTHER.
